fn start_scheduler()

in glean-core/src/scheduler.rs [191:244]


fn start_scheduler(
    submitter: impl MetricsPingSubmitter + Send + 'static,
    now: DateTime<FixedOffset>,
    when: When,
) -> JoinHandle<()> {
    let pair = Arc::clone(&TASK_CONDVAR);
    std::thread::Builder::new()
        .name("glean.mps".into())
        .spawn(move || {
            let (cancelled_lock, condvar) = &*pair;
            let mut when = when;
            let mut now = now;
            loop {
                let dur = when.until(now);
                log::info!("Scheduling for {} after {:?}, reason {:?}", now, dur, when);
                let mut timed_out = false;
                {
                    match condvar.wait_timeout_while(cancelled_lock.lock().unwrap(), dur, |cancelled| !*cancelled) {
                        Err(err) => {
                            log::warn!("Condvar wait failure. MPS exiting. {}", err);
                            break;
                        }
                        Ok((cancelled, wait_result)) => {
                            if *cancelled {
                                log::info!("Metrics Ping Scheduler cancelled. Exiting.");
                                break;
                            } else if wait_result.timed_out() {
                                // Can't get the global glean while holding cancelled's lock.
                                timed_out = true;
                            } else {
                                // This should be impossible. `cancelled_lock` is acquired, and
                                // `!*cancelled` is checked by the condvar before it is allowed
                                // to return from `wait_timeout_while` (I checked).
                                // So `Ok(_)` implies `*cancelled || wait_result.timed_out`.
                                log::warn!("Spurious wakeup of the MPS condvar should be impossible.");
                            }
                        }
                    }
                }
                // Safety:
                // We are okay dropping the condvar's cancelled lock here because it only guards
                // whether we're cancelled, and we've established that we weren't when we timed out.
                // We might _now_ be cancelled at any time, in which case when we loop back over
                // we'll immediately exit. But first we need to submit our "metrics" ping.
                if timed_out {
                    log::info!("Time to submit our metrics ping, {:?}", when);
                    let glean = crate::core::global_glean().expect("Global Glean not present when trying to send scheduled 'metrics' ping?!").lock().unwrap();
                    submitter.submit_metrics_ping(&glean, Some(when.reason()), now);
                    when = When::Reschedule;
                }
                now = local_now_with_offset();
            }
        }).expect("Unable to spawn Metrics Ping Scheduler thread.")
}
